Appium Testing With Real Gadgets Sauce Labs Documentation

You Will see a loading display screen, after which the app will launch in a live test window using the device you selected. Use the search box and filters to find the gadget you wish to take a look at on, or select the device in the grid. The W3C WebDriver Protocol take a look at functionality syntax differs from that of JWP, so it’s necessary to make sure you configure your checks accurately so your intended protocol is followed and your settings are utilized accurately. As new gadgets and new/beta OS’s turn into out there, we add them to your environment. Inside the high stage process described above, there are many nuances that can affect the usefulness of your test outcomes. IOS 17.5 and iOS 18 Simulators on Apple Silicon are solely obtainable to Enterprise prospects with the suitable subscription plan.

sauce labs mobile testing

As the W3C WebDriver Protocol is supported in Appium v1.6.5 and better, and required for Appium v2.zero, we suggest and assist utilizing it exclusively in your check scripts as an alternative of the JSON Wire Protocol (JWP). Apple has transitioned from Intel to their proprietary Apple Silicon architecture, massively shifting the development and testing panorama. Sauce Labs helps us find and repair issues that we by no means considered exploring up to now. As A Outcome Of of the visibility that Sauce Labs gives us, we deal with issues in the improvement part instead of reacting to customer-reported points. If you’re looking for an various to Microsoft App Middle, this article will cover the highest concerns, and how Sauce Labs handles these in its Cell App Distribution providing.

Sauce Labs continues to spend cash on its unified platform, ensuring improvement teams have the protection, pace, and insights needed to release high quality software with confidence. Our public cloud, obtainable to all customers no matter pricing plan, contains a wide array of totally cleaned units. On the cellular gadget selection display screen, if a device is in use, it’s going to be marked with a In Use flag.

This StackOverflow article contains instructions on tips on how to construct an .apk file in Eclipse. We had an extended listing of things we needed options for and Mobile App Distribution TestFairy checked all those packing containers for us.” “With Mobile App Distribution we have been in a position to cut our testing cycle by 50% with higher quality.”

  • Sauce Labs helps us find and fix points that we never considered exploring up to now.
  • With end-to-end capabilities across construct, test, deploy, and launch, teams can continuously enhance their high quality processes and ship quicker.
  • Be Part Of our automated testing specialists for 3 in-depth, digital classes designed particularly to assist you ship exceptional cell experiences with confidence.

If you do not have an app, consider using the Sauce Labs demo app for validating your account functionality as nicely as your exams. The app and its data will nonetheless be uninstalled and reinstalled for the following check, however. Dynamic allocation is advised sauce labs mobile testing, in particular, for all automated cellular app testing in CI environments.

Simplify Flutter Integration Testing With Sauce Labs Actual Gadget Cloud

Uploaded and hosted in Sauce Labs storage or put in from a distant location. On the Stay Cell Apps Testing page, you probably can search for and select the specified app construct from the dropdown list to begin testing. To view uploaded app builds or change the app settings, on the App Administration page, hover over the app after which click Settings and App Variations. To skip the uninstallation and reinstallation of your app from the device, you can set noReset to true in conjunction with utilizing a cacheId.

sauce labs mobile testing

Real System Automated Check Time Limits​

You can use real devices to test both native apps and internet apps in a cellular browser. The platformName functionality is the only take a look at configuration that’s mandatory no matter which type of mobile test you may be writing, as it specifies whether or not the check is for iOS or Android. Our Take A Look At Configuration Choices reference documentation offers a whole index of required and optional parameters for Appium. Be aware that not all of the Appium capabilities listing are supported for each virtual and actual gadget exams and that some capabilities have driver-specific options for Android and iOS shopper libraries. Energy your cellular and web apps at scale with the most comprehensive answer for software program high quality. Test, launch, and innovate confidently with AI-driven insights grounded in real knowledge.

Accelerate App Delivery, Enhance High Quality, and Reduce Stress Across Your Cellular Engineering Groups. Michael has spent the last 20 years working with software program and SaaS options that help DevOps leaders and engineers overcome the challenges they face of their every day roles.

The following sections provide context and instructions for take a look at configurations that are important when utilizing Appium to run automated tests on Sauce Labs actual units. See Appium Versions for details about Appium variations supported for real device testing. And Sauce Labs may help you test where your prospects are – on the newest devices, with iOS 18 and past – to deliver quality app experiences from day one.

Leading behavioral health expertise supplier Qualifacts partnered with Sauce Labs to implement automated testing that saved testing time whereas maintaining the standard and compliance of their critical healthcare software program. With the shift to Apple Silicon, sustaining compatibility and efficiency has turn out to be increasingly challenging. Sauce Labs helps testing of iOS 18 and above, ensuring your mobile testing aligns seamlessly with Apple’s evolving ecosystem. This is specifying fundamental parameters for your test by setting deviceName to the Display Name and or platformVersion to the OS Model by common expressions (regex) to dynamically allocate a tool. (If you need to use the OS Version you want to trello remove the Android or iOS prefix from the OS version).

Real Device Cloud

It allows developers to check across various browsers and devices, ensuring compatibility and efficiency. This platform helps enhance quality, improve effectivity, and reduce prices by streamlining testing from development to post-release. By choosing Sauce Labs, you streamline your testing workflow, accelerating improvement cycles and guaranteeing high-quality software program releases.

Share this post

Leave a Reply

Tu dirección de correo electrónico no será publicada. Los campos necesarios están marcados *